Love Live! Nijigasaki High School Idol Club
This project, launched in 2017, is the third installment in the "Love Live!" series. Unlike previous series that focused on "aiming for the top as a group," the Nijigasaki High School Idol Club (Nijigaku) operates on the concept of "each member pursuing their own dreams." Its unique style involves individual members working as solo idols, sometimes collaborating. Players take on the role of "you," supporting the club members, making the relationship feel more personal. This relationship between "you" and the school idols is crucial in the context of the line "Senpai, I like you, I like you!". The animated series meticulously portrays each member's solo songs and individuality, establishing diverse fan bases. Kasumi Nakasu is one such member, with numerous solo songs and episodes highlighting her unique personality. Nijigaku embodies the philosophy of "diversity," embracing a wide range of character personalities, which contributes to its broad appeal among fans.
Kasumi Nakasu
A first-year (later second-year) student belonging to the Nijigasaki High School Idol Club. Her image color is light yellow, and her nickname is "Kasumin." Despite her cute, small-animal-like appearance, her charm lies in a slightly "darker," calculating, and mischievous side. However, at her core, she harbors a pure desire to "be the cutest of all" and "be loved by everyone," which serves as the driving force behind her school idol activities. The line "Senpai, I like you, I like you!" may seem like a straightforward expression of affection, but for fans who deeply understand her character, it is regarded as the epitome of "Kasumin-ness"—a exquisite blend of "calculated cuteness" and "genuine, pure affection." She knows how to maximize her appeal and possesses the talent of an entertainer who keeps fans engaged. Her "gap moe" (the appeal of unexpected contrasts), occasional vulnerabilities, and above all, her passion for school idols, continue to captivate many fans.
School Idol
A key term symbolizing the entire "Love Live!" series and forming the core of its narrative. Unlike typical idols, school idols refer to "student idols" who form groups themselves while affiliated with a school, performing in schools and local communities. Through singing and dancing, they liven up school life, sometimes save their schools from closure, or simply pursue their own dreams and goals. School idols are depicted not merely as entertainment performers, but as embodiments of youthful radiance, the bonds of friendship, and the passion for "things that can only be done now." In the "Love Live!" works, the growth of school idols and their journey of overcoming challenges inspire courage and emotion in viewers and players. Kasumi Nakasu, too, has a dream of "being the cutest" as a school idol and works hard every day to achieve it.
